Before promoting the Gildhall seat-map renderer, confirm the stage environment renders all balcony tiers without overlap and that hold-state polling completes under 400ms. The renderer fetches layouts from the internal Plottery service, which requires release-scoped authentication. Export the credential into RENDER_ENV before the smoke test; the key to use follows below.

service key, fawip-bajef: kto11_Qt5wZK9vdNC

Quick note for team assistants: the archive room in the basement of Bracken House is where we keep old contracts, event kits, and the mysterious box labelled "Do Not Bin (Seriously)". If someone asks you to fetch a file, grab the trolley from the mail room first — the corridor is narrow. Sign the clipboard on the door each visit. The door code you'll need is just below.

turnstile pass: bdg-QZV-3

## Connection pool tuning

The Ferrowick API uses a shared pool against the primary database. Defaults are sized for two app replicas; if you add replicas, scale the per-instance maximum down accordingly or the database hits its global connection ceiling. Idle connections are reaped on a timer. The current pool constants are as follows.

tuning table, yajog-yahof:
BUDGETS = {
    "lamvan": 303,
    "wenox": 460,
    "fenvan": 525,
}

Finance Review Summary — Incoming Director

Launch plan for the Veltro payments module: budget approved at committee, contingency trimmed 8%. Marketing spend front-loaded to weeks one through four. Breakeven projected within three quarters assuming Harwick region uptake holds. Supplier terms with Quollan Systems finalised. Outstanding risk: staffing in the Delmsford office. Strategic rationale and next-phase intentions are summarised in the note below.

management briefing: Jorixax Holdings is in early talks to buy Casixax Holdings for about $420.3 million. The Fenmir launch date is October 27, and nothing goes to the press before then. Legal wants the Keloxek Foods term sheet redrafted before April 16.